Located in Boston, MA, Emmanuel College offers a strong pre-med track rooted in its Biology & Life Sciences, Health Sciences, and Nursing programs. The college emphasizes hands-on learning and clinical exposure, leveraging Boston’s rich medical environment to prepare students for medical careers.
Emmanuel College provides a solid foundation in the sciences with supportive faculty, helping many pre-med students prepare competitively for medical school admission.
